The Station pub in Altrincham has announced it will undergo a major £250,000 refurbishment this month.

The much-loved spot says it will relaunch as a ‘stylish, completely reimagined destination’. The venue will be fully remodelled throughout, featuring a brand-new bar, upgraded toilets, new flooring, and enhanced lighting, alongside the launch of a striking new outdoor courtyard space complete with ambient lighting and wall projections.

A significant new audio-visual upgrade sees 12 HD screens installed throughout the venue, including in the courtyard. Entertainment is central to the new Station experience, with free pool tables and interactive darts available for guests, alongside full sports coverage across all major events.

The venue also offers several semi-private areas available for hire, with a range of drinks packages on offer. A partnership with Nell’s will also offer guests a dedicated click-and-collect service.

Chris Tulloch, Managing Director at Blind Tiger Inns, said: “The Station has been part of Altrincham for a long time. We wanted to completely transform the space to attract a different clientele and offer something for everyone – from after-work drinks and live sport to summer evenings outdoors in a modern, aesthetic setting. We’re excited to welcome both familiar faces and new guests back through the doors.”

The Station will re-open to the public on Fri 30 Jan.
